StoneX

Senior Java Developer

Job Locations IN-Pune
Requisition ID 2024-12486
Category (Portal Searching)
Information Technology
Position Type (Portal Searching)
Experienced Professional

Overview

Connecting clients to markets – and talent to opportunity

With 4,300 employees and over 400,000 retail and institutional clients from more than 80 offices spread across five continents, we’re a Fortune-100, Nasdaq-listed provider, connecting clients to the global markets – focusing on innovation, human connection, and providing world-class products and services to all types of investors.

At StoneX, we offer you the opportunity to be part of an institutional-grade financial services network that connects companies, organizations, and investors to the global markets ecosystem. As a team member, you'll benefit from our unique blend of digital platforms, comprehensive clearing and execution services, personalized high-touch support, and deep industry expertise. Elevate your career with us and make a significant impact in the world of global finance.

 

Business Segment Overview

 

Payments: A Swift-accredited service bureau and member, our Payments division provides NGOs, institutions and non-profits the ability to make a local difference, globally – with transparent pricing across 180+ countries and 140+ currencies.

Responsibilities

Position Purpose : 

 

An experience Senior Java Developer who can Design Solutions and Solve problems for complex Business Requirements in an evolving space of Global Payments Business. Technically sharp and has multi dimensional approach on solving problems. 

 

Primary duties will include: 

  • Actively work with Product Management team to translate product requirements and functional maps to technical design and frameworks.
  • Prepare and review technical specifications and review code. Where required have the ability to code as well.
  • Validate development builds and provide early feedback. Ensure high quality development delivery.
  • Nice to have good understand of payment systems including real time capabilities.
  • Good understanding of emerging opportunities in the areas of CI/CD and cloud based deployment
  • Support production support teams to help resolve production issues and support them with tools that improve their productivity.
  • Work Collaboratively with Agile Team Members to deliver Maximum Business Value.
  • Guide and Groom Junior Developers on Java J2EE technology stack

Qualifications

Qualifications: 

 

                    8+ Years of Software Development Experience.

  • Developing applications on Java SpringBoot Framework using Java.
  • Messaging/Integration middleware products such as Kafka and Rabbit MQ
  • Web Frameworks, Micro Front Ends – HTML, CSS, JS, React framework
  • Relational Databases such as SQL Server and Non-relational Databases such as MongoDB
  • Object-Oriented Design & Development
  • Agile Development Techniques with hands on experience workign with process tools such as Azure DevOps, JIRA
  • Software Versioning system such as SVN and Git 
  • Unit Testing Frameworks and Test Automation Frameworks 
  • Microsoft Azure cloud infrastructure with exposure to deploying using Docker Containers with Kubernetes
  • CI/CD pipeline process and applications

Working environment: 

  • Hybrid/In-office/Remote  ( 3 days WFO - subject to change)
  • Travel Requirements (if applicable)

Options

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ed